Health officials warn about potential measles exposure

Seattle, Wash. –Health authorities in Washington are warning of a potential measles exposure at Seattle-Tacoma Airport.

Officials are investigating a case of measles in a traveler who was at the airport during their contagious period.

Health officials say the risk to the public is generally low due to people being vaccinated against the disease.

They say if travelers are not immune to measles they are mostly likely to become sick between September 13th and September 27th.

Measles is a highly contagious and potentially severe disease. In rare circumstances, it can be deadly.
